## Kiosk Watchdog (Perchlight)

The Perchlight watchdog restarts the kiosk shell on heartbeat loss (>15s). It reports uptime metrics to the internal Lanternbay collector every minute over mTLS. No user data leaves the device. Restarts are logged with a monotonic counter to detect crash loops. The collector accepts reports only with the key below.

service key, kaduf-bawig: kto15_Ze79S0dligTw0yO

**Onboarding: Stale-Cache Postmortem (Cardle incident)**

Read this before touching the cache layer. Last quarter, Cardle served week-old pricing because the invalidation worker lost auth to the cache bus and failed silently. Fixes shipped: worker now crashes loudly on auth failure, and the bus token moved out of code into the env file. Every new dev environment must set it or the worker won't boot. After cloning the repo and copying the env template, append the line below.

sealed setting: VAULT_KEY20=69e2a0b23f1a79fbf692

This fragment covers releasing DocSentry, the linter that checks our documentation tree for broken anchors, stale version strings, and untranslated placeholders. As a new contractor, you only need the promotion step: run the full lint suite against the `docs-main` snapshot, confirm zero errors (warnings are acceptable), then build the release tarball with the standard pipeline. Do not edit rule configs during a release window; file a follow-up instead. Once the tarball is built, sign it with the release key that appears below.

release key, tajep-tahaf: bky19_d9NV5NtNvNNQVVKBK4P

Subject: DR drill recap — invoice renderer

Hey all, quick note for the sync: we ran the disaster-recovery drill on Paperwick, our PDF invoice renderer, Thursday. Failover to the Dunmere region took 11 minutes — mostly font-cache warmup, which Tomas is fixing. Rendering parity checks all passed. One gap: restoring the template vault required the break-glass path. For the next drill, the vault unlocks with the recovery passphrase listed right below.

recovery phrase for bawep-kawef: oliath-casdor